Position Summary Tucked away in a series of underground vaults beneath a grassy pasture, the Jasper Hill cheese care team turns and brushes cheeses, salting them, spiking them, washing them in brine, all to transform them from young, bland wheels into some of the country’s most celebrated artisan cheese. We blend centuries-old cheese ripening techniques with the latest scientific understanding in order to coax the highest possible expression from our cheeses. The work is fast-paced and often physical, but allows the opportunity to work alongside a dedicated team that’s committed to the highest standards of quality.
